-
Notifications
You must be signed in to change notification settings - Fork 0
/
file.json
1 lines (1 loc) · 9.97 KB
/
file.json
1
{"User.a73e4189-8a11-4b84-93e7-22229e90ace7": {"id": "a73e4189-8a11-4b84-93e7-22229e90ace7", "created_at": "2024-06-29T08:12:59.570638", "updated_at": "2024-06-29T08:12:59.570656", "first_name": "Betty", "last_name": "Bar", "email": "airbnb@mail.com", "password": "root", "__class__": "User"}, "User.a7f27d0b-2df9-43cd-b4f6-9c9ab0b451d2": {"id": "a7f27d0b-2df9-43cd-b4f6-9c9ab0b451d2", "created_at": "2024-06-29T08:13:31.375537", "updated_at": "2024-06-29T08:13:31.375550", "first_name": "Betty", "last_name": "Bar", "email": "airbnb@mail.com", "password": "root", "__class__": "User"}, "User.1e0ca3b4-8487-4528-92d3-545b9e17dc78": {"id": "1e0ca3b4-8487-4528-92d3-545b9e17dc78", "created_at": "2024-06-29T08:14:38.272770", "updated_at": "2024-06-29T08:14:38.272783", "first_name": "Betty", "last_name": "Bar", "email": "airbnb@mail.com", "password": "root", "__class__": "User"}, "Course.e97fa553-af7e-4065-b206-b12a7c4516eb": {"id": "e97fa553-af7e-4065-b206-b12a7c4516eb", "created_at": "2024-06-29T08:14:38.274350", "updated_at": "2024-06-29T08:14:38.274359", "name": "BitDev", "description": "A great course for Bitdevs", "__class__": "Course"}, "Course.f6aed2d0-bf16-4fbd-bcab-ef89f3174a4c": {"id": "f6aed2d0-bf16-4fbd-bcab-ef89f3174a4c", "created_at": "2024-06-29T08:15:08.772521", "updated_at": "2024-09-10T02:50:40.474975", "name": "LN Bootcamp", "description": "The new way to do Bootcamp and Hack on Bitcoin and Lightning", "chapters": [{"name": "Bitcoin Fundamentals", "Goals": ["Introduction to Bitcoin", "Bitcoin's core concepts", "Cryptography in Bitcoin", "Bitcoin transactions", "Bitcoin mining and Proof of Work", "Bitcoin network", "Bitcoin scripting language", "Handson: Setting up a Bitcoin node"], "Ressources": ["History and creation of Bitcoin", "Satoshi Nakamoto's whitepaper", "Decentralization on Bitcoin", "Immutability", "Consensus mechanisms", "Public and private keys", "Digital signatures", "Hash functions", "Structure of a transaction", "UTXOs (Unspent Transaction Outputs)", "Transaction fees", "Mining process", "Block rewards and halving", "Difficulty adjustment", "Nodes and their types", "P2P network structure", "Propagation of transactions and blocks", "Basic script operations", "Multisig transactions", "Time locks", "Installing Bitcoin Core", "Syncing the blockchain", "Basic node operations"]}, {"name": "Advanced Bitcoin and Introduction to Lightning Network", "Goals": ["Segregated Witness (SegWit)", "Bitcoin Scaling Challenges", "Introduction to Layer 2 solutions", "Lightning Network Fundamentals", "Payment channels", "Hashed Timelock Contracts(HTLCs)", "Lightning Network Routing", "Lightning Network implementations", "Handson: Setting up a Lightning node"], "Ressources": ["Segwit Purpose and benefits", "Segwit Impact on transaction malleability", "Block size debate", "Transaction through put limitations", "State channels", "Sidechains", "LN Origins and creators", "Core concepts and architecture", "Opening and closing channels", "Channel states and updates", "HTLCs Purpose and structure", "Atomics swaps", "Onion routing", "Path finding algorithms", "LND", "CLightning", "Eclair", "Installing LND", "Creating and funding channels"]}, {"name": "Building on the Lightning Network", "Goals": ["Lightning Network protocol deep dive", "Lightning Invoices", "Lightning Network APIs", "Lightning wallets development", "Lightning Network security considerations", "Advanced Lightning Network features", "Integration with existing applications", "Handson: Building a simple Ligthning-enabled application"], "Ressources": ["BOLT Specifications", "Lightning message types", "Invoices structure and encoding", "Payment requests and LNURL", "gRPC API overview", "REST API usage", "Key management", "Channel management", "Payment processing", "Channel monitoring", "Watchtowers", "Backup and recovery strategies", "Multipath payments", "Atomics multipath payments (AMP)", "Sphinx send", "Ecommerce Integration", "Streaming payments", "Gaming applications", "Creating and processing invoices", "Sending and receiving payments"]}, {"name": "Lightning Network in Practice and African Context", "Goals": ["Lightning Network economics", "Lightning Network analytics and monitoring", "Understanding Africa's unique challenges", "Impact of Lightning Network on Africa's challenges", "Lightningpowered app ideas for African markets", "Best practices for Lightning Network development", "Future developments in the Lightning Network", "Final project: Designing a Lightning Network solution for an African use case"], "Ressources": ["Fee structures", "Liquidity management", "Channel rebalancing strategies", "Network explorers", "Capacity analysis", "Node ranking and centrality", "Financial inclusion issues", "Infrastructure limitations", "Regulatory landscape", "Remittances and crossborder payments", "Micropayments and new business models", "Banking the unbanked", "Mobile money integration", "Payasyougo services", "Agricultural supply chain solutions", "Testing and simulation", "Dealing with edge cases", "Performance optimization", "Eltoo", "Taproot and Schnorr signatures integration", "Channel factories", "Group brainstorming and ideation", "Rapid prototyping", "Presentations and feedback"]}], "__class__": "Course"}, "User.c983a441-0987-4939-a825-374878ee5a12": {"id": "c983a441-0987-4939-a825-374878ee5a12", "created_at": "2024-06-30T17:37:47.491991", "updated_at": "2024-09-10T05:05:25.458676", "email": "al@gmail.com", "password": "1234", "name": "AL", "github_username": "AlphonseMehounme", "__class__": "User"}, "Course.ecc45022-b9b4-40ec-a7b3-3fe0b9acc085": {"id": "ecc45022-b9b4-40ec-a7b3-3fe0b9acc085", "created_at": "2024-06-30T17:42:01.842790", "updated_at": "2024-06-30T17:45:34.140955", "description": "THE NEW ALX BTC", "name": "New Name", "__class__": "Course"}, "Course.3b358816-81ce-4ae9-98c4-7ab65eba4186": {"id": "3b358816-81ce-4ae9-98c4-7ab65eba4186", "created_at": "2024-07-01T06:58:09.140117", "updated_at": "2024-07-01T06:58:09.140150", "description": "Our new great course", "name": "Hello", "__class__": "Course"}, "Category.65e50994-bbd5-4140-9557-92c4ced891ad": {"id": "65e50994-bbd5-4140-9557-92c4ced891ad", "created_at": "2024-07-01T14:26:29.212362", "updated_at": "2024-07-01T14:26:29.212375", "name": "LN courses", "__class__": "Category"}, "Course.fa3b585a-7718-44cc-b92e-42518926791f": {"id": "fa3b585a-7718-44cc-b92e-42518926791f", "created_at": "2024-09-09T23:26:42.778126", "updated_at": "2024-09-09T23:26:42.778461", "name": "LN Bootcamp", "__class__": "Course"}, "User.5f92a866-3496-440d-9b82-d48232f5d469": {"id": "5f92a866-3496-440d-9b82-d48232f5d469", "created_at": "2024-09-13T22:53:23.277327", "updated_at": "2024-09-13T22:53:23.277338", "first_name": "Alphonse", "last_name": "Mehounme", "username": "mehounme", "email": "alphonsemehounme9@gmail.com", "password": "Iamtheone", "git_username": "AlphonseMehounme", "__class__": "User"}, "User.a8b86cdc-2022-471d-b1ea-15be3286e620": {"id": "a8b86cdc-2022-471d-b1ea-15be3286e620", "created_at": "2024-09-13T22:53:43.829547", "updated_at": "2024-09-13T22:53:43.829561", "first_name": "Alphonse", "last_name": "Mehounme", "username": "mehounme", "email": "alphonsemehounme9@gmail.com", "password": "Iamtheone", "git_username": "AlphonseMehounme", "__class__": "User"}, "User.d5b5bdf5-65a3-4309-b748-fdb2db191ca1": {"id": "d5b5bdf5-65a3-4309-b748-fdb2db191ca1", "created_at": "2024-09-13T22:57:01.053300", "updated_at": "2024-09-13T22:57:01.053312", "first_name": "Alphonse", "last_name": "Mehounme", "username": "mehounme", "email": "alphonsemehounme9@gmail.com", "password": "Iamtheone", "git_username": "AlphonseMehounme", "__class__": "User"}, "User.35e4b623-127b-4e62-b0e5-de855c28bd21": {"id": "35e4b623-127b-4e62-b0e5-de855c28bd21", "created_at": "2024-09-13T23:27:56.309799", "updated_at": "2024-09-13T23:27:56.309809", "first_name": "", "last_name": "", "username": "", "email": "", "password": "", "git_username": "", "__class__": "User"}, "User.3c6bff8b-9dab-4c80-84da-6f72dcb1a237": {"id": "3c6bff8b-9dab-4c80-84da-6f72dcb1a237", "created_at": "2024-09-13T23:44:46.025469", "updated_at": "2024-09-13T23:44:46.025484", "first_name": "", "last_name": "", "username": "", "email": "", "password": "", "git_username": "", "__class__": "User"}, "User.4d6bf31e-15ba-4331-8c33-1ffa02063718": {"id": "4d6bf31e-15ba-4331-8c33-1ffa02063718", "created_at": "2024-09-14T00:06:04.705609", "updated_at": "2024-09-14T00:06:04.705621", "first_name": "", "last_name": "", "username": "", "email": "", "password": "", "git_username": "", "__class__": "User"}, "User.9d9e8608-803d-4760-a725-181ea023405c": {"id": "9d9e8608-803d-4760-a725-181ea023405c", "created_at": "2024-09-14T01:03:58.199248", "updated_at": "2024-09-14T01:03:58.199259", "first_name": "", "last_name": "", "username": "", "email": "", "password": "", "git_username": "", "__class__": "User"}, "User.9d3c0b0c-d950-4360-9e18-ac8355f222da": {"id": "9d3c0b0c-d950-4360-9e18-ac8355f222da", "created_at": "2024-09-14T01:08:21.044690", "updated_at": "2024-09-14T01:08:21.044703", "first_name": "", "last_name": "", "username": "", "email": "", "password": "", "git_username": "", "__class__": "User"}, "User.17131869-c577-4755-b293-265b6248a9db": {"id": "17131869-c577-4755-b293-265b6248a9db", "created_at": "2024-09-14T01:10:11.754832", "updated_at": "2024-09-14T01:10:11.754843", "first_name": "", "last_name": "", "username": "", "email": "", "password": "", "git_username": "", "__class__": "User"}, "User.57a8ef0d-c28d-4054-840f-cd448b38814a": {"id": "57a8ef0d-c28d-4054-840f-cd448b38814a", "created_at": "2024-09-15T10:00:14.774158", "updated_at": "2024-09-15T10:00:14.774196", "first_name": "Clarisse", "last_name": "Tomavo", "username": "Clarisse", "email": "tomavoclarisse@gmail.com", "password": "tgrfde15.", "git_username": "@tomavoclarisse", "__class__": "User"}, "User.35e927fc-58a5-4628-8b00-481f528eec95": {"id": "35e927fc-58a5-4628-8b00-481f528eec95", "created_at": "2024-09-15T10:41:30.489606", "updated_at": "2024-09-15T10:41:30.489623", "first_name": "Guest", "last_name": "Guest", "username": "guest", "email": "guest@bes.com", "password": "12345", "git_username": "guest", "__class__": "User"}}